    16, COVENTRY STREET, BRIGHTON, BN1 5PQ

    This terraced freehold property on Coventry Street last sold in February 2013 for £435,000. Based on price growth in the BN1 district since then, its estimated current value is £680,313 — placing it in the 89th percentile nationally and the 80th percentile within BN1. The property covers 122 m² (1,313 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£5,576 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of C.

    BN1 covers central Brighton, including the seafront and city centre, forming part of the South Coast's major urban area. It is a vibrant, densely populated neighbourhood popular with young professionals, students, and diverse communities.
